Introduction to the Modeling Framework in Kujiale
In the mold base industry, the use of advanced technology and software can significantly enhance the design and manufacturing process. Kujiale, a leading provider of modeling and design solutions, offers a powerful modeling framework that enables professionals in the mold base industry to streamline their workflows and improve overall productivity. In this step-by-step guide, we will explore how to effectively use the modeling framework in Kujiale.
Step 1: Accessing the Modeling Framework
To begin using the modeling framework in Kujiale, you need to first access the software platform. Log in to your Kujiale account and navigate to the "Modeling Framework" section. Here, you will find a comprehensive set of tools and features specifically designed for mold base professionals.
Step 2: Understanding the User Interface
Familiarizing yourself with the user interface is essential to effectively use the modeling framework in Kujiale. The interface consists of various panels, toolbars, and command options. Take some time to explore and understand the different components of the interface, as it will greatly facilitate your modeling process.
Step 3: Creating a New Project
Once you are comfortable with the interface, it's time to create a new project. Click on the "New Project" button to initiate the project creation wizard. This wizard will guide you through the necessary steps to set up your project, such as defining the project name, selecting the mold base type, and specifying the required materials.
Step 4: Importing Existing Designs
If you already have existing designs or models that you want to incorporate into your project, Kujiale allows you to import them seamlessly. Click on the "Import Design" button and select the appropriate file format (e.g., STEP, IGES) to import your designs. Ensure that the imported designs align with the project specifications and requirements.
Step 5: Modeling the Mold Base
With your project set up and designs imported, you are ready to start modeling the mold base. The modeling framework in Kujiale offers a wide range of intuitive modeling tools that enable you to create precise and accurate mold base components. Utilize features such as extrusion, filleting, and mirroring to efficiently build your mold base.
Step 6: Applying Advanced Features
Besides the basic modeling tools, Kujiale's modeling framework also provides advanced features to enhance your design. Utilize features like parametric modeling, where you can define parameters and equations to drive the model's behavior. Additionally, you can apply assembly features like constraints and joints to efficiently assemble the various components of the mold base.
Step 7: Analyzing and Validating the Model
Once your mold base model is complete, it is crucial to analyze and validate its integrity and functionality. Kujiale's modeling framework offers built-in analysis tools that allow you to check for issues such as interference, clearance, and proper component alignment. Use these tools to ensure your mold base is free from errors before proceeding to the manufacturing stage.
Step 8: Generating Manufacturing Documentation
After successfully modeling and validating the mold base, Kujiale's modeling framework allows you to generate comprehensive manufacturing documentation. This documentation typically includes detailed 2D drawings, bill of materials, and other necessary specifications. Review the documentation thoroughly to ensure accuracy and completeness.
